Bank Citadele – communication campaign of restructuring and launch of the
       new brand

       Summary

              One the back of the liquidity crunch one of the TOP 3 banks in Latvia was
       taken over by the State in order to preserve the stability of Latvian financial sector.
       After stabilisation of the situation; a new shareholder – the EBRD – was attracted and
       the Bank’s restructuring was started. As a result new bank with a new brand was
       created and clients from former Parex banka were transferred to the new bank – bank
       Citadele.
              In a time of a crisis and in every changing situation a wide integrated
       communication campaign about the restructuring and split of Parex banka was
       carried out, including extensive public relations, internal communication and
       marketing activities. All activities were organised by the Bank’s internal team, also
       coordinating the work of out-source providers – creative agency, event organisers.
              All communication activities were based on providing extensive information to
       the target audiences in 13 countries, using as much direct communication as possible
       and organising special events for target audiences in order to explain all issues and
       answer all concerns in person.
              As soon as in August 2010 more than 88% of Latvian inhabitants have heard
       about establishment of bank Citadele and its brand. Especially good results were
       achieved in the groups with higher income (more than 99% with income above 600
       LVL). The Bank’s client base stabilised and new business was attained – deposits
       grew and new loans were issued.

Situation

               One the back of the liquidity crunch one of the TOP 3 banks in Latvia was
       taken over by the State in order to preserve the stability of Latvian financial sector.
       After the stabilisation of the situation; a new shareholder – the EBRD – was attracted
       and the Bank’s restructuring was started. As a result new bank with a new brand was
       created and clients from former Parex banka were transferred to the new bank.
               The brand of Parex banka is related to crisis and very negative attitude of
       Latvian inhabitants.
               The Bank’s restructuring is highly dependent on political situation and
       functionaries; hence, the Bank may not recon with precise timings and other
       preconditions.
Objectives
               To preserve existing client base and to motivate clients to stay with the New
       Bank after the crisis, taking into account extensive competition in the market.
          To ensure effective communication in all target audiences before the actual split
       date, including communication of the new brand, providing objective information of
       the slit process and creation of the positive informational background for the new
       Bank’s operations:
          - To enhance the clients’ loyalty,
          - To motivate the Bank’s employees,
          - To inform all target audiences about the restructure process.
          Target audiences: Clients, potential clients, employees, shareholders and
       investors, Eurobond owners and holders of other financial instruments, syndicated
       lenders and financial institutions, opinion leaders and brand specialists in Latvia,
       media and general public.

Strategy
          In order to ensure effective communication in all target audiences about the
       restructuring process all communication activities were based on providing extensive
       information to the target audiences in 13 countries, using as much direct
       communication as possible and organising special events for target audiences in
       order to explain all issues and answer all concerns in person.
           -   To communicate bank’s Citadele new brand to the main target audiences by
       organising a series of brand opening and client events; hence, drawing a virtual line
       between old bank and new bank and creating a stable base for sufficient brand
       communication in the mid-term;
           -   To inform the main target audiences about the restructuring process by
       establishing new information channel - jaunabanka.lv, gathering all information about
       the restructuring process, opinions and comments by experts, State institution and
       the Bank’s representatives, as well as Q&A), the website was launched 2 months
       prior to the split date and later was integrated in the website of bank Citadele.

Execution
          All communication activities were developed dependant on several important dates
       in the restructuring process of Parex banka, putting the main emphasis on:
     1. Information
              a. Through the Bank’s channels (websites in 13 languages and countries)
              b. Development of new communication channels (www.jaunabanka.lv)
              c. Direct mailings to clients and collaboration partners, clients of resolution
                 bank (Parex banka)
              d. Extensive internal communications campaign
              e. And indirectly through media relations activities
              f. Media campaign (interviews, comments and opinions, interviews, media kits
                 to regional media etc., supported by the advertising campaign closer to the
                 split date)
     2. Direct communication
              a. Instructions and Q&A for client managers and hotline employees
     3. Special events
              a. New brand reveal event for defined 200 guests and photo opportunity for
                 news media,
b. Events for media(Press conference with Parex banka and bank Citadele
                 management after the split),
              c. Events for clients (top corporate client conference, event for top private
                 banking clients from the CIS, meeting with the new management, marking of
                 first 150 customers of bank Citadele on the day of opening),
              d. Internal forums and manager meetings.

              This solution ensured that all of target audiences were informed not only about
        the new brand, but also about the planned transfer; thus, enabling the bank Citadele
        to start operations without any major disturbances in the communication field.

Documented Results
       All communication activities ensured achieving of the set goals:
           - The public was well informed about the restructuring of Parex banka and
       establishment of bank Citadele; affirmed by the results of snapshot poll, showing
       that 88% of Latvia’s inhabitants have heard about establishment of bank Citadele
       and its brand. Especially good results were achieved in the groups with higher
       income;
           - In July and August 2010 the 12 spokespersons of both bank Citadele and
       Parex banka were among top 20 in the Latvian media.
           - In the first days after the split more than 6490 visits from 52 countries to bank’s
       Citadele websites.
           - Although in June 2010 Parex banka had the greatest number of publicity
       (1194), it had the largest amount of negative publications (91). While in July and
       August 2010 share of voice peaked both for Parex banka(35 and 33%) and bank
       Citadele (17% and 16%). In August both banks had the highest publicity efficiency
       index – 38.37% and 38.24% respectively. The positive and neutral publicity
       reached 98% and only 2% of publications were fairly negative.
           - Clients were well informed about the split process and received the split
       calmly,
           - Direct communication with the most crucial target audiences was ensured,
           - An increase in the Bank’s business was observed, including 18% increase in
       deposits (compared to July 2010), stabilisation of the client base.
